War - Ww1 - Ae 1 The Lost Australian Submarine



They went to Rabaul to take the German radio out
With an Australian force to stop German cruisers sailing about
From their China Station to stop Allied ships plying their trade
One day AE1 left the harbour for patrols to be made
And disappeared where no contact was ever had
Only the report of islander people who saw a devil fish quite mad

For one hundred years their families have not known
And for all of this time their sadness has grown
Now the RAN will search again for our Great War submarine
Setting their side sonar for underwater information to glean
And finally give them back to their families who have felt the lost
Of each sailor our nation now continues to count the Great War cost..

POET'S NOTES ABOUT THE POEM
AE1 Australia's first submarine was lost with all hands in 1914 off Rabaul.It left the harbour and was never seen again.
